World’s first marine cemetery opens in Kerala

The world’s first marine cemetery, made with single-use plastic bottles, opened its gates at Beypore Beach in the South Indian state of Kerala.

The cemetery pays respect to eight critically endangered marine species, such as the seahorse, parrotfish, hammerhead shark, leatherback turtle, dugong, sawfish, eagle ray, zebra shark and Miss Kerala. And aims to create awareness on the devastating effects of single-use plastic, urban and industrial pollution, and overfishing.
